Get ready to step into the shoes of James Bond.

Amazon MGM Studios and independent video game developer IO Interactive have officially launched “007 First Flight,” a new game that reimagines James Bond’s origin story as the 26-year-old fights his way through MI6’s elite training program. This is the first James Bond game in 15 years.

An official description of the game reads: “For the first time in video games, fans will be able to experience Bond’s ascent at MI6 from a recruit into a fully-fledged spy, as his sharp instincts, resourcefulness, and heroism propel him through the ranks and into the world of high-stakes covert operations.”

The game also features an original theme by Lana Del Rey and David Arnold, who scored five of the James Bond films. The voice cast is rounded out by Gemma Chan, Lenny Kravitz, Patrick Gibson, Priyanga Burford and Alastair McKenzie.

“With 007 First Light, we set out to honor the incredible legacy of 007 while creating a Bond gaming experience like no other,” IO Interactive CEO Hakan Abrak said in a statement. “This is a Bond still finding his footing, one players can grow with on his journey shaped by instincts, intelligence, and the resolve that ultimately built the character’s lasting impact.”
